I had this happen to me at the most perfect moment. My daughter needed to change her outfit at the soccer field and I wanted her to change in the back of the van. She refused because she insisted everyone would see her. I promised her no one could see in with our tinted windows and plus I would hold up a blanket, etc etc. I couldn't persuade her.

Then, this little kid walks up to our van and starts making the most ridiculous faces at himself in the window. I wish I would have thought to film it. Anyway, my daughter and I were in hysterics, but I had definite proof, "NOW do you believe me? You cannot see in and no one will see you change!!"

The car interior is darker than the outside so the kid sees his reflection rather than the inside of the car. No tinted windows or new glasses needed.
